Fried my brain.
User sent an email home, changed the file, saved it, emailed it back to work and also to their AOL account as a backup. At work they saved the attachement from outlook and there are no changes, open the attachement in AOL email and the file has the changes from the night before. The same file!
How can this be?
I checked. I sent myself a document that said "test". I got it at home and changed it to "test done", emailed it to my outlook work and cc:ed my hotmail.
Today hotmail file says "test done" outlook file says "test". Same file!
Any clue?
